Adelphian Civic Club hosts Ninth Dist. Fall Convention, discusses new project covering bullying in schools (10/29/09)

Missouri GFWC Officers with the 9th District President attending the 9th District Fall Convention hosted in Kennett. From left, MIssouri Vice-President, Lisa Cook; Missouri President, Pat Zachary; Missouri President-elect, Carolyn Lovelace; and 9th District President, Sheri Hickey.

The Adelphian Civic Club recently hosted its Ninth District Fall Convention of the General Federation of Women's Clubs (GFWC) of Missouri, Inc., and received information about a new project established by the GFWC titled PRISM.

PRISM, or "Promoting Respect in Schools in Missouri," was introduced by Springfield, Mo., State President, Pat Zachary, during the convention. President-elect, Carolyn Lovelace, of Lathrop, Mo., explained that the project was in connection with Missouri Senate Bill no. 894, which regards the subject of "bullying" in schools. Several ways for the clubs to work with local schools to help diffuse the problem were discussed following the introduction and explanation.


The convention was hosted on Saturday, October 17, at the First United Methodist Church Christian Life Center, in Kennett, with the theme of "Walking in Tall Cotton," chosen by the Kennett club. As a memento of the area, each lady attending received a cotton boll corsage, which coincided with the cotton boll bouquets displayed in high-heeled shoes on each table.

The meeting was called to order by President of the Ninth District, Sheri Hickey, of Farmington, Mo., who was joined at the convention by other officers including, Ninth District President-elect, Kathy Hartig, of St. Genevieve, Mo.; Recording Secretary, Kathy Tate, of St. Genevieve, Mo.; and Parliamentarian, Alice Goehman, of Arcadia, Mo.

Following the meeting being called to order, the presentation of colors was presented by local Girl Scout Troop #264, with leaders Glenda Jaine and Melinda Mowrer.


Next, Chamber of Commerce Director, Jan McElwrath, representing the city, welcomed the group to Kennett.

Also in attendance fro the event were State officers of the GFWC including, Missouri State President, Pat Zachary, of Springfield, Mo.; President-elect, Carolyn Lovelace, of Lathrop, Mo.; and Vice President, Lisa Cook, of Fayette, Mo.

During the conference, Zachary reviewed events of the past year and presented award and recognition to the outstanding clubs of District 9, according to member Paula Calhoun.

Zachary also updated the clubs on the activities of Missouri Girls Town, located in Kingdom City, Mo.

Entertainment at the event, performing prior to lunch, consisted of Rev. Gary Carter, Dianne Carter, Larry Swindle, and Daryl Wilcoxson. The lunch served following the entertainment was prepared by Pat Mitchell of the Traveling Whisk.


The event concluded with a live silent auction to raise funds for the Sophomore Pilgrimage, a program established by the GFWC over 75 years ago. The Sophomore Pilgrimage provides sophomore students, from schools across Missouri, the opportunity to tour the State Capitol and other sites in Jefferson City, Mo., along with meeting state representatives and other government officials.

A total of 11 clubs throughout the district were represented at the meeting and Adelphian Club President, Anita Brogden, expressed appreciation to all who attended and helped make the event a success.
